From last.fm:
Full of Hell is a hardcore punk/grindcore band formed in 2009 and based in Ocean City, Maryland and central Pennsylvania. They are signed to A389 Recordings and have released two full-length albums on the label, Roots of Earth Are Consuming My Home (2011) and Rudiments of Mutilation (2013). They've also recorded split EPs with Code Orange Kids, Goldust, and Calm The Fire, as well as a split single with The Guilt Øf.... Full of Hell have also released noise recordings, the FOH NOISE series, which currently has four volumes that were originally released on cassette via Arctic Night Records. From last.fm:
Ambassador Gun (formerly known as A Second From the Surface) was formed in the late 90’s by Luke Olson and Tim Sieler and played as a three piece grindcore band in Minneapolis. Their most recent album, When In Hell, was released in 2008 by Lost Archives Records. Their last album as A Second From the Surface, “The Streets Have Eyes”, was released internationally by This Dark Reign Recordings on May 8th, 2007.
